The Hidden Costs of Poor Scheduling

Every missed call or delayed response costs a practice more than just a potential appointment. It damages the patient's perception of reliability. Patients who struggle to book often seek alternatives, leading to lost revenue and diminished reputation. By implementing a robust CRM solution, clinics can automate scheduling, send reminders, and manage cancellations seamlessly. This not only saves time but also demonstrates that the practice values the patient's time.

The Power of Integration

When scheduling, billing, and communication tools work together, staff spend less time on data entry and more time on patient care. Integration reduces errors and eliminates the need to repeat information. For example, when a patient books online, their details automatically populate the CRM, and a confirmation is sent immediately. Later, the system can trigger a follow-up survey or a reminder for a future visit. This seamless workflow impresses patients and boosts operational efficiency.
